Size: a a a

JavaScript Noobs — сообщество новичков

2020 September 19

AB

Anton Branch in JavaScript Noobs — сообщество новичков
В функции где Обьект возвращаешься его через return.

Передашь в другую функцию функцию, что возвращает один или два объекта.
Перебором цикла, или мап редюс уже обьединяешь. .
источник

AB

Anton Branch in JavaScript Noobs — сообщество новичков
func mObj1 (return obj1)

func mObg2 (return obj2)

func mergeObj (mObj1, mObj2)
Цикл для перебора пар ключей.
Для проверки ключей можно использовать hasOwnerPrototype.
источник

L

Lev Tonov in JavaScript Noobs — сообщество новичков
Тимерлан
пишет object name  not defined.я хочу данные одного объекта заменить или добавить к данным другого объекта.(оба объекта, напомню,не в глобальной видимости)
Можно попробовать создать map и уже оттуда управлять объектами. Удалять или добавлять что надо встроенными методами.
источник

L

Lev Tonov in JavaScript Noobs — сообщество новичков
Тимерлан
пишет object name  not defined.я хочу данные одного объекта заменить или добавить к данным другого объекта.(оба объекта, напомню,не в глобальной видимости)
Там, кстати, можно проверить есть ли какие-то ключи или нет, и в зависимости от этого можно добавлять и удалять значения. В общем все ограничивается твоей фантазией
источник

L

Lev Tonov in JavaScript Noobs — сообщество новичков
Тимерлан
пишет object name  not defined.я хочу данные одного объекта заменить или добавить к данным другого объекта.(оба объекта, напомню,не в глобальной видимости)
источник

ɵ

ɵ in JavaScript Noobs — сообщество новичков
Доброе утро
Почему эта конструкция выводит только 0?
источник

ɵ

ɵ in JavaScript Noobs — сообщество новичков
Также был бы благодарен, если кто-то подскажет ресурс попростейшим задачкам на жс, пока дошёл только до уровня простых функций
источник

ɵ

ɵ in JavaScript Noobs — сообщество новичков
Окей, а почему тогда цикл

for (let i = 2; i <= 10; i++) {
 if (i % 2 == 0) {
   alert( i );
 }
}

Также не завершается на нуле?
источник

DM

Denys Mikhalenko in JavaScript Noobs — сообщество новичков
потому что здесь условие выхода из цикла i <= 10 и все
источник

ɵ

ɵ in JavaScript Noobs — сообщество новичков
Denys Mikhalenko
потому что здесь условие выхода из цикла i <= 10 и все
Понял, да, спасибо
источник

DM

Denys Mikhalenko in JavaScript Noobs — сообщество новичков
ок, я немного неправильно объяснил
источник

DM

Denys Mikhalenko in JavaScript Noobs — сообщество новичков
правильнее было бы сказать, это условие НЕ-выхода из цикла
источник

DM

Denys Mikhalenko in JavaScript Noobs — сообщество новичков
пока оно верно - цикл продолжается
источник

DM

Denys Mikhalenko in JavaScript Noobs — сообщество новичков
то есть пока i <= 10 - цикл продолжается
источник

DM

Denys Mikhalenko in JavaScript Noobs — сообщество новичков
в первом случае первая итерация совершается, потому что оба условия верны для 0, но для 1 уже неверно второе условие 1 % 2 !== 0
источник

DM

Denys Mikhalenko in JavaScript Noobs — сообщество новичков
поэтому цикл прекращается
источник

ɵ

ɵ in JavaScript Noobs — сообщество новичков
Denys Mikhalenko
поэтому цикл прекращается
Ясно. благодарю
источник

L

Lev Tonov in JavaScript Noobs — сообщество новичков
ɵ
Также был бы благодарен, если кто-то подскажет ресурс попростейшим задачкам на жс, пока дошёл только до уровня простых функций
источник

ɵ

ɵ in JavaScript Noobs — сообщество новичков
Lev Tonov
Платно?
источник

ɵ

ɵ in JavaScript Noobs — сообщество новичков
Lev Tonov
Спасибо🙏
источник